"Erasmus for Young Entrepreneurs" is a new European exchange programme aimed at helping new entrepreneurs to acquire relevant skills for managing a small or medium-sized enterprise (SME) by spending time working in another EU country with an experienced entrepreneur in his or her company.

Entrepreneurial spirit is well developed in the ICT sphere but the lack of risk investment instruments and the insufficient business practices of the entrepreneurs restrict the development of the companies in the industry. Within its policy of improving the environment for development of SMEs (small and medium-sized enterprises) the Bulgarian ICT Cluster is launching a project, called FORENTIN – Forum for Entrepreneurs and Investors.

The project “ICT Broadband Platform for Bulgaria” has been created like similar initiative, successfully adopted in Austria in 2004-2005. Thanks to the expert assessment and recommendations of the companies participating in the project, in 2005 the Austrian government adopted ICT strategy that included wide range of activities which would make Austria one of the top 5 ICT countries in Europe.
The initiative “ICT Broadband Platform for Bulgaria” started in 2006.

ACHIEVE MORE is being developed as part of the Competitiveness and Innovation Programme of the European Commission by nine partners: St John's Innovation Centre (UK), EuConnect Ltd (UK), EBN (Belgium), Innovationsbron (Sweden), Finance Tree (UK), UKBI (UK), Institute for Work & Technology (Germany), Gate Garchinger (Germany) and CERAM Sophia Antipolis Business School (France).
